NAME
linefind - Detect vertical features in images
SYNOPSIS
linefind [options] -o output.pto input.pto
DESCRIPTION
linefind is a detector for vertical features in images. It tries to find
vertical lines using the same algorithm as Calibrate_lens_gui and assigns
vertical control points to them. The detection runs on the source images,
if the input images are rectilinear images. In the other cases (e. g. fish-
eye images) the input images are reprojected to an equirectangular projec-
tion and the detection works on the reprojected images. It uses the roll
value, saved in the pto project file, to determine what is "top" and "bot-
tom". So before running linefind check that your roll values are correct
(E. g. when using images straight from the camera, use a roll value of 0
for landscape and a value of 90 or 270 for portrait images. If your camera
has an orientation sensor, Hugin can detect this information automatically
and sets the roll value accordingly when adding such images into Hugin.
OPTIONS
-o|--output output.pto
Output Hugin PTO file. Default: '<filename>_line.pto'.
-l|--lines num
The maximum number of lines added per image (default: 5) Attention:
Keep in mind that more vertical control points will dominate the opti-
misation in favour of "normal" control points.
-i|--image num
Image number(s) to process. Normally linefind tries to find vertical
lines in all images of the project file. If you want to limit the de-
tection to some selected images, you can use this parameter. Can be
used multiple times.
-h|--help
shows help
